Bowles, John, was born in Oxfordshire, England, Jannary 22, 1840, and came to the United States with his parents,
who located in Jefferson county, N. Y., in the year 1851. He was educated in the district schools and Watertown
High school and is a thorough farmer. Mr. Bowles is a member of Brownville Lodge No. 53, F. & A. M., and the
fami1y is of English origin on both sides. His father, William Bowles, was born at the old home in England, August
3, 1816; he was a ship carpenter and the last years of his life were spent as a farmer. He married Mary Fawdrey
of hs native place and they had five children: Anna M., Eliza, John, Levi, and Mary B. Anna M. married Marcus Taylor;
Eliza married William N. Reeves and Levi married Mary J. Harris. All of the daughters have been very successful
teachers for many years. Mary resides with her brother John. William Bowles died October 8, 1887, and his widow
January 20, 1896.
